Your Purpose
As Sous Chef, you’ll support our Head Chef in leading the kitchen, ensuring that every meal is prepared with care and served with pride. From roast dinners to birthday cakes, you’ll help make every mealtime special tailored to the tastes, preferences and nutritional needs of our residents.
You’ll also take an active role in planning menus, supervising kitchen assistants, and maintaining a clean, safe kitchen environment. When the Head Chef is away, you’ll step up with confidence.
